Definitions:

Stock Dividend

A dividend payment made in additional shares of a company's stock instead of cash.

Cash Dividend

A distribution of earnings made by a company to its stockholders, often in the form of profits.

Stock Split

A corporate action that increases the number of shares by dividing each share, which typically reduces the price per share.

Retained Earnings

The portion of a company's profits that are kept or retained and not paid out as dividends to shareholders, often used for reinvestment in the business.
